Horse Camp at Wildcat Mountain State Park offers RV campers an ideal basecamp for exploring one of Wisconsin's most scenic natural areas. Situated on a dramatic ridge overlooking the Kickapoo River Valley near Ontario, this campground provides essential amenities including water hookups, fire pits, picnic tables, and modern toilet facilities—perfect for big rigs and families alike.
The park features 21 miles of well-maintained hiking and nature trails, making it a haven for trail enthusiasts. Beyond hiking, guests enjoy access to paddling on the nearby Kickapoo River, with equipment rentals available in the village of Ontario.
The setting balances adventure with comfort: day hikes lead to panoramic vistas of the Kickapoo Valley, while on-site amenities like grills, playgrounds, and picnic areas support relaxation and family recreation. Evening stargazing rewards visitors with clear night skies away from urban light pollution.
Established in 1948, Wildcat Mountain State Park carries a rustic, nature-focused character that appeals to outdoor adventurers and families seeking authentic Wisconsin wilderness.
